Tuition by Program

This school charges tuition on a per-program basis. Costs vary depending on the program of study.

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se

25 months

$45,360
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training

15 months

$24,488
Medical/Clinical Assistant

8 months

$16,297
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ant

24 months

$29,950
Dental Assisting/Assistant

9 months

$16,297
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ant
$14,507

Tuition at Ross College-Canton varies by program — from $14,507 to $45,360 across 6 programs. With financial aid factored in, students pay an average net price of $32,292.

Financial Aid Overview (2022-23)

The vast majority of first-time students at Ross College-Canton — 88% — receive some form of grant or scholarship, averaging $4,925 per student.

Students Receiving Any Financial Aid

84 of 84 students

100%

Grants & Scholarships

Recipients

74 (88%)

Average Award

$4,925

Student Loans (2022-23)

Most students at Ross College-Canton borrow: 88% take out federal student loans, averaging $9,708 per borrower. Planning for repayment should start early.
